Precision-manufactured to tight tolerances, this 0.126" thick, 21" wide, and 36" long sheet is comprised of 316 stainless steel. Known for its excellent resistance to pitting and crevice corrosion in chloride environments, 316 alloy is ideal for marine, chemical processing, and food/beverage industries. Its enhanced strength and formability make it suitable for demanding fabrication tasks, ensuring reliable performance in aggressive conditions. | 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using a standard carbon steel blade for cutting. | Always use a blade specifically designed for stainless steel, such as carbide-tipped or diamond grit, to ensure clean cuts and prolong blade life. |
| Applying excessive force or speed during cutting. | Maintain a consistent, moderate feed rate and allow the blade to do the work. Excessive force can lead to blade binding, overheating, and poor cut quality. |
